Mercedes-Benz was sued as part of the broader diesel emissions scandal — similar to the Volkswagen Dieselgate case — for allegedly equipping its BlueTEC diesel vehicles with software that produced lower emissions during testing than during real-world driving. Regulators required Mercedes to perform an Approved Emissions Modification on affected vehicles to bring them into compliance with emissions standards.
Mercedes-Benz agreed to provide cash incentive payments to owners who had the AEM performed on their vehicles as compensation for the inconvenience and any diminution in vehicle performance or value resulting from the modification.
